Qual è la differenza tra Education, Instruction, Learning, Teaching e Training?

Education: The process of learning and teaching. Instruction: a set of steps or guidance on how to do something Learning: The process of gaining knowledge or skills. Teaching: Helping someone learn something. Training: Learning or practicing skills for a job or sport.

Puoi mostrare un esempio di ciascuna?

Education: Education is the key to success in life. Instruction: The teacher gave clear instruction on how to complete the assignment. Learning: Learning a new language can be very rewarding. Teaching: Teaching can be a rewarding profession that impacts many lives. Training: The athlete is undergoing rigorous training to prepare for the competition.

Posso usare Education, Instruction, Learning, Teaching e Training in modo intercambiabile?

Non sempre. Education, Instruction, Learning, Teaching e Training sono affini e a volte si sovrappongono, ma differiscono per registro, frequenza e uso, quindi scambiarle può cambiare il significato o il tono. Controlla le differenze qui sopra prima di sostituire.
